Many women entering menopause begin noticing changes that feel unfamiliar to their body. Sleep becomes lighter. Energy drops. Weight becomes harder to manage. Libido changes. Intimacy may feel uncomfortable, and mood shifts can feel more intense than before.

These symptoms are often dismissed as β€œjust aging,” but hormonal changes involving estrogen, testosterone, cortisol, thyroid function, and metabolism can affect nearly every system in the body. Sexual wellness is connected to whole-body health, not just reproductive health alone.

The good news is that personalized support may help improve energy, confidence, sleep, metabolic health, and intimacy during this transition. Lifestyle medicine, hormone optimization, nutrition, stress management, and comprehensive care can help you feel more connected to your body again.

Feeling weaker, more fatigued, or noticing changes in body composition even though your habits have not changed? Struggling with stubborn weight gain, slower recovery, low motivation, or declining energy levels?

Muscle health is deeply connected to hormone health. Hormones like testosterone, estrogen, cortisol, insulin, and growth hormone all influence muscle maintenance, metabolism, strength, and recovery. As muscle mass declines, metabolic health and energy production can become more difficult to maintain.

The good news is that targeted lifestyle changes, resistance training, proper nutrition, sleep optimization, and personalized hormone support may help improve strength, energy, body composition, and overall wellness.

Feeling more anxious, exhausted, irritable, or mentally foggy lately? Struggling with sleep changes, stubborn weight gain, low libido, or cycles that suddenly feel unpredictable?

Many women are told these symptoms are β€œjust stress” or simply part of aging, but perimenopause can begin years before menopause and often affects far more than reproductive health. Hormonal shifts involving estrogen, progesterone, cortisol, thyroid function, and metabolism can influence how you feel physically and emotionally every day.

The good news is that early support and personalized care may help improve energy, mood, sleep, metabolic health, and sexual wellness so you can feel more like yourself again.

Intermittent fasting may feel very different depending on your stress levels, sleep quality, activity demands, and overall recovery.

For some people, fasting can feel supportive and energizing during certain seasons of life. For others, especially during periods of higher stress or poor recovery, it may feel harder to maintain and less effective than it once did.

You may notice:
β€’ Lower energy in the morning
β€’ Difficulty recovering from workouts
β€’ Increased irritability or brain fog
β€’ Stronger hunger or cravings
β€’ Feeling more fatigued instead of energized

That does not necessarily mean you are doing something β€œwrong.”

The body responds differently depending on factors like stress, sleep, hydration, nutrition, hormones, activity level, and overall metabolic health. Strategies that once felt helpful may need adjustment as your body’s needs change over time.

This is why wellness approaches are rarely one size fits all.

For some people, modifying meal timing, improving recovery, supporting sleep, reducing stress, or creating a more balanced nutrition plan may feel more sustainable and supportive than pushing through exhaustion.

The goal is not simply to follow trends or force stricter routines.
It is to create habits that support energy, recovery, metabolic wellness, and long term consistency in a way that works with your body, not against it.

Most people think yoga is only about flexibility or stretching.

But for many people, its value goes far beyond mobility.

Recovery and metabolic wellness are not only influenced by intense workouts or cardio sessions. They are also shaped by how the body responds to stress, restores energy, and recovers between periods of physical and mental demand.

This is where practices like yoga can become helpful.

Through controlled movement, breathing, and mindfulness, yoga may help support:
β€’ Stress management
β€’ Recovery and relaxation
β€’ Mobility and flexibility
β€’ Mind body awareness
β€’ Overall wellness routines

Many people focus only on doing more training, more cardio, or more intensity without paying equal attention to recovery and nervous system balance.

But long term wellness often depends on both effort and recovery working together.

That is why many balanced wellness routines include a combination of:
βœ” Strength and movement training
βœ” Recovery focused practices
βœ” Stress management habits
βœ” Sleep and recovery support
βœ” Sustainable lifestyle structure

The goal is not simply to do more.
It is to create routines your body can consistently recover from and adapt to over time.
